Ark. Code Ann. § 19-5-1117

Arkansas Tobacco Settlement Commission Fund

(1) There is established on the books of the Treasurer of State, the Auditor of State, and the Chief Fiscal Officer of the State a fund to be known as the “Arkansas Tobacco Settlement Commission Fund”.

(2) The Arkansas Tobacco Settlement Commission Fund shall consist of investment earnings transferred from the Tobacco Settlement Program Fund and each of the Tobacco Settlement Program Accounts as provided in § 19-12-108 and interest earnings.

(3) The Arkansas Tobacco Settlement Commission Fund shall be used for those purposes set out in § 19-12-108, administered by the State Board of Finance.
